Born in Boston, USA, the eighth of ten children, he left school after only two years because his parents could not afford to pay. He started working for his brother James, a printer, and later established his own printing company in Philadelphia. Eventually, he became the owner of a newspaper, the Pennsylvania Gazette.

In addition to his printing endeavors, he founded America's first lending library, a significant contribution to education. He also began publishing the first in a series of almanacs, yearly books containing interesting facts, stories, and puzzles. The success of these publications made Franklin wealthy.

As his printing business thrived, Franklin decided to retire from printing to dedicate more time to his passion for science and experiments. He published important works on electricity and conducted his famous experiment with a kite during a storm, leading to groundbreaking discoveries.

Later in life, Franklin became the first American Ambassador to France, where he worked tirelessly to improve the relationship between the two countries. Eventually, he retired from politics but continued to be a prominent figure in intellectual circles.

At the age of 84, Franklin passed away, leaving behind a remarkable legacy. His funeral was attended by an astonishing 20,000 people, a testament to the profound impact he had on his country and the world.

Born in Boston, USA, as the eighth of ten children, Benjamin Franklin faced financial constraints that forced him to leave school after only two years. Undeterred, he entered the workforce and began working for his brother James, who was a printer. Eventually, Franklin ventured out on his own and established a printing company in Philadelphia.

His entrepreneurial spirit thrived, leading him to become the owner of the Pennsylvania Gazette, a newspaper that played a significant role in his financial success. Not content with his achievements in the printing industry, Franklin went on to establish America's first lending library, promoting access to knowledge and education.

In addition to his contributions to the world of literature, Franklin delved into publishing almanacs, yearly books filled with interesting facts, stories, and puzzles. The success of these publications contributed significantly to his wealth. Seizing the opportunity to focus on other pursuits, Franklin retired from printing to dedicate more time to science and experiments.

His groundbreaking work in electricity marked a turning point in his career. Franklin conducted his famous kite experiment, unraveling key principles of electricity. This scientific achievement added to his already impressive legacy.

Franklin's talents were not confined to the realms of science and literature; he played a crucial role in diplomacy. He became the first American Ambassador to France, where he worked tirelessly to strengthen the relationship between the two nations. His diplomatic efforts were instrumental in fostering goodwill and cooperation.

After a successful political career, Franklin chose to retire, culminating a life marked by diverse accomplishments. He passed away at the age of 84, leaving behind a legacy that resonated with many. His funeral drew an enormous crowd, with 20,000 people paying their respects, a testament to the profound impact he had on his contemporaries and future generations.
